The development of intrinsic stacking faults in the ordered alloys was studied using electron microscopy. Analysis of the recombination of split dislocations indicated that wide stacking faults were to be expected following high-temperature working. The addition of Cr to Ni3Fe reduced the energy of the (a/6)<112> stacking faults and increased the splitting. The estimated stacking-fault energy was about 25mJ/m2.
